Chelsea boss Tuchel upset Lukaku with "daddy" comment during Tottenham game

ChelseamanagerThomas Tuchelreportedly annoyedRomelu Lukakulast season by making a joke about the Belgian striker’s relationship withAntonio Conte.

Lukaku has been announced as an Inter Milan player for the 2022/23 season after Chelsea agreed a deal to send himback to Italy on a season-long loan. Chelsea shelled out a club-record £97.5million fee to sign their former player from Inter last summer, but have now offloaded him after just one season at Stamford Bridge.

Inter will pay a loan fee of £6.9m for Lukaku’s services next season, but will not be paying his £325,000-a-week wages in full. The 29-year-old is back in Milan and has now completed all the paperwork to ensure the loan will become official in the coming days.

Lukaku’s return to Chelsea never appeared to be a good fit, with Tuchel’s tactics at odds with the Belgium striker’s style of play. He scored just eight goals in 26 Premier League appearances last season and clashed with Tuchel by giving a controversial interview to Sky Italia in December in which he criticised the manager’s tactics.

It now appears that it wasn’t just tactically that the two were not compatible. Goal’s Chelsea reporter Nizaar Kinsella says that Lukaku was offended by a comment Tuchel made last season while the two were watching a Tottenham game together.

Speaking on theItalian Football Podcast, Kinsella said: “Romelu Lukaku was chatting to Thomas Tuchel while watching a Premier League match, a Spurs game, and Thomas Tuchel goes ‘There’s your daddy’ about Antonio Conte. It was just a joke, but apparently it didn’t go down very well.”

Conte and Lukaku enjoy a close relationship, having worked together for two years at Inter Milan. The two combined brilliantly in the 2020/21 season as Inter won Serie A for the first time in 11 years and both have spoken about their fondness for each other.

When Conte left Inter last summer, Lukaku paid tribute to him on Instagram. "You came at the right time and basically changed me as a player and made me even stronger mentally and more importantly we won together!” he wrote.

“I will keep your principles for the rest of my career ( physical preparation, mental and just the drive to win…) it was a pleasure to play for you! Thank you for all what you did. I owe you a lot.. @antonioconte.”
